A homicide investigation is underway following the death of a woman at an apartment complex in Boyle Heights.
Officers received a report of a person down on the 100 block of Cummings Street near 1st Street at around 10 a.m. Wednesday, according to a spokesperson for the Los Angeles Police Department (LAPD).
Upon arrival, officers found the victim, described only as a female Hispanic in her 70s. She was pronounced dead at the scene. A cause of death is not yet known, police said.
The incident is being investigated as a possible homicide, though no suspect information was available at the time of this report. LAPD Central Bureau Homicide is handling the investigation.
